Transaction 83598f899b54d8c832b4e06b7b0b69306960cba5e4ebc440e0ed57c4bc9dac68
1 Input
1 Output
-
83598f899b54d8c832b4e06b7b0b69306960cba5e4ebc440e0ed57c4bc9dac68:0
- value
- 1799867
- script pubkey
- OP_0 OP_PUSHBYTES_20 0d343434b40d9dbb058e614aff770ab58465d5cb
- address
- bc1qp56rgd95pkwmkpvwv9907ac2kkzxt4wtwqlqf5